Frequently Asked Questions About Roofing in Rhine

Get answers to common questions about roofing services in Rhine, Georgia.

1What is the typical cost range for a new asphalt shingle roof in Rhine, GA?

For a standard single-family home in Rhine, a full asphalt shingle roof replacement typically ranges from $8,500 to $15,000, with the final cost heavily dependent on your roof's square footage, pitch, and the quality of materials chosen. Regional material and labor costs in Georgia influence this range, and it's crucial to get itemized estimates from local contractors that include tear-off, disposal, and any necessary decking repair. Investing in impact-resistant shingles rated for Georgia's severe hail and wind can be a wise long-term consideration for our climate.

2When is the best time of year to schedule a roof replacement in our area?

The ideal scheduling windows in the Rhine/Dodge County area are late spring (April-May)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er the most stable, dry weather, which is critical for proper installation and material adhesion. Summers can be intensely hot and prone to afternoon thunderstorms, while winter, though generally mild, can bring unpredictable rain that delays projects. Scheduling during these shoulder seasons also helps you avoid the contractor backlog common during peak storm season.

3Are there specific local building codes or permits required for roofing work in Rhine?

Yes, roofing work in the City of Rhine and unincorporated Dodge County generally requires a building permit, which your licensed contractor should pull on your behalf. Georgia's building codes, including the International Residential Code (IRC) with state amendments, mandate specific requirements for wind resistance (important for our occasional severe storms) and proper underlayment. A reputable local roofer will be familiar with these codes and will schedule the required final inspection by the county building official to ensure compliance.

4How do I choose a reliable roofing contractor serving the Rhine community?

Prioritize contractors who are locally based, licensed and insured in Georgia, and have a verifiable physical address. Ask for references from recent jobs in Dodge or surrounding counties and check their standing with the Georgia Secretary of State. A trustworthy roofer will provide a detailed, written estimate, offer manufacturer warranties on materials and their own workmanship warranty, and will not pressure you with high-pressure storm-chaser tactics common after local hail events.

5What are the most common roofing problems for homes in Rhine due to our local climate?

The most frequent issues stem from our high humidity, intense summer sun, and seasonal severe thunderstorms. These conditions lead to accelerated granule loss and UV degradation of shingles, thermal cracking, and damage from wind-driven rain and hail. Proper attic ventilation is also a critical, often overlooked, defense against heat and moisture buildup that can warp decking and shorten roof life. Regular inspections, especially after spring and summer storms, are key to catching minor damage before it leads to major leaks.
